Dell EMC OpenManage Integration for Microsoft System Center (OMIMSSC) for SCCM and SCVMM versions prior to 7.2.1 contain a hard-coded cryptographic key vulnerability that could be exploited by a remote attacker.
Understanding CVE-2020-5374
This CVE involves a vulnerability in Dell's OMIMSSC software that could allow unauthorized access to appliance data for remotely managed devices.
What is CVE-2020-5374?
The CVE-2020-5374 vulnerability is a hard-coded cryptographic key issue in Dell EMC OpenManage Integration for Microsoft System Center (OMIMSSC) versions below 7.2.1.
The Impact of CVE-2020-5374
The vulnerability poses a high severity risk, with a CVSS base score of 8.8. It could lead to unauthorized access to sensitive data on the affected devices.

Vulnerability Description
The vulnerability in OMIMSSC versions prior to 7.2.1 stems from a hard-coded cryptographic key, enabling remote unauthenticated attackers to gain access to appliance data.
